Topics Covered
- 1. Introduction to FPGA Security: Learners will study the basics of Field-Programmable Gate Arrays (FPGAs) and their role in security. They will gain foundational knowledge of security threats, countermeasures, and the importance of integrity and confidentiality in FPGA-based systems.
- 2. Cryptographic Techniques for FPGA Security: This module covers essential cryptographic techniques and their implementation on FPGAs. Learners will understand symmetric and asymmetric encryption, hash functions, and digital signatures, and how to apply them in secure FPGA designs.
- 3. Physical Security Measures for FPGAs: Learners will explore physical security threats to FPGAs and the measures to protect against them. Topics include side-channel attacks, tamper-resistance techniques, and secure boot processes.
- 4. FPGA-Based Hardware Security Modules: This module delves into the design and implementation of Hardware Security Modules (HSMs) using FPGAs. Learners will learn how to create secure and reliable cryptographic operations within FPGA-based systems.
- 5. Advanced Cryptographic Protocols and Algorithms: Learners will study advanced cryptographic protocols and algorithms optimized for FPGAs. This includes topics such as homomorphic encryption, secure multi-party computation, and quantum-resistant algorithms.
- 6. Secure FPGA Design Practices: This module focuses on best practices for secure FPGA design, including secure coding techniques, secure hardware-software interfaces, and secure design verification.
- 7. Security in FPGA-Based Network Devices: Learners will examine security challenges in FPGA-based network devices and solutions to mitigate these risks. Topics include secure network interfaces, intrusion detection systems, and secure firmware updates.
- 8. Case Studies in FPGA Security: Through case studies, learners will analyze real-world scenarios and solutions for securing FPGAs in various applications. This module aims to enhance practical understanding and application of theoretical knowledge.
- 9. Legal and Ethical Considerations in FPGA Security: This module covers legal and ethical aspects of FPGA security, including data protection regulations, intellectual property rights, and the ethical implications of security measures in FPGA-based systems.
- 10. Future Trends in FPGA Security: Learners will explore emerging trends and future directions in FPGA security, including the integration of machine learning and AI in security systems, and the impact of emerging technologies on FPGA security.
